I got the #5 pick in our draft coming up on Saturday. This is the most important league to me. 10 team. No PPR.

I assume that the following will be available:
Gore
CJ4.24
Slaton
LT
DWill

I'm leaning towards Gore due to his reliability and consistency week in and week out, but I really like Slaton this year. Both backs are not expected to time share. Then, there is also CJ4.24, LT, and DWill. I don't want SJAX.

Thoughts? Please help. WHIR

In a non-ppr, Chris Johnson is out. I like Slaton, but in a non-ppr hurts his value. LT has been going 5th/6th in a lot of mocks I've been doing. Even a so-so LT is good for 1200 yds and 10-12 td's. I may be in the minority with this, but DWill would be a good pick here. He's looked very good in the preseason and J Stewart is hurting w/ a sore achilles. Now, DWill might not put up another 20 td's, but he could be in the 13-16 td range. I'm with you, I'd stay away from SJax (esp. in a non-ppr).

I would rank them: DWill, LT, Slaton, Gore, CJ4.24
